-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: SHA1 - ------------------------------------------------------------------------- Debian Security Advisory DSA-2461-1 security () debian org http://www.debian.org/security/ Moritz Muehlenhoff April 26, 2012 http://www.debian.org/security/faq - ------------------------------------------------------------------------- Package : spip Vulnerability : several Problem type : remote Debian-specific: no CVE ID : not yet available Several vulnerabilities have been found in SPIP, a website engine for publishing, resulting in cross-site scripting, script code injection and bypass of restrictions. For the stable distribution (squeeze), this problem has been fixed in version 2.1.1-3squeeze3. For the testing distribution (wheezy), this problem has been fixed in version 2.1.13-1. For the unstable distribution (sid), this problem has been fixed in version 2.1.13-1. We recommend that you upgrade your spip packages.
